The Forbidden Blossom of Demon's Bloodline
In the shadowed realms of a kingdom where the demon king's reign was as iron-fisted as it was dark, there lived a tale of forbidden love that would echo through the ages. The demon king, known as Xian, was a fearsome figure, his name whispered with fear and reverence. His heart, however, harbored a secret love for a human woman, Elara, whose gentle spirit and radiant beauty were as rare as the moon in the night sky.
Elara was a village girl, a farmer's daughter with a heart full of dreams. She never knew that her fate was to become entangled in the cruel tapestry of the demon king's life. One fateful night, as the stars danced in the velvet sky, Elara's life changed forever. Xian, driven by a love so fierce it could not be contained, came to the village, seeking the woman whose laughter had echoed in his dreams. In a passionate embrace, they crossed the forbidden line, and Elara bore his child, a child whose existence threatened the very fabric of the kingdom.
The child, named Lyra, was born with eyes that held the fire of her mother's love and the darkness of her father's lineage. Her hair, a cascade of midnight black, was as unyielding as the demon king's will. But her skin was alabaster, a testament to her human heritage. Lyra was a living contradiction, a creature of both light and shadow, a demon's bloodline and a human's soul.
From the moment she opened her eyes, Lyra was shrouded in mystery and fear. The kingdom's laws were clear: demons and humans were to remain apart. Yet, Xian's love for Elara and his child was as immutable as the mountains that towered over their home. He shielded Lyra from the world's eyes, keeping her in a secluded tower where she could grow in peace.
As Lyra grew, so did her powers, a strange alchemy of her two worlds. She could command the winds with a whisper and feel the emotions of those around her with the clarity of a crystal bell. But with her growing abilities came the whispers of her true nature, and the shadows of her lineage began to call to her.
In the depths of the forest, where the trees whispered ancient secrets and the spirits of the earth danced in the underbrush, Lyra encountered a young man named Kael. Kael was a guardian of the forest, a sentinel against the encroaching darkness. He saw in Lyra a kindred spirit, a creature of light and shadow, and felt an immediate connection.
Kael's life was simple, but his heart was full of a love for the forest and its creatures. He was drawn to Lyra, but he knew the dangers that lay in wait for them both. The demon king's wrath was a storm that could consume them all, and the kingdom's laws were as rigid as the stone walls that enclosed the tower.
Lyra and Kael's friendship blossomed into something more, a forbidden love that defied all odds. They spoke of dreams and futures, of a world where the line between demon and human was blurred and love was the greatest power of all. But as the truth of Lyra's heritage became more apparent, so did the danger they faced.
The demon king, feeling his power waning and his heart torn by love and loss, sought to claim his child. He sent his most fearsome warriors to the forest, intent on capturing Lyra and forcing her to embrace her demon nature. Kael, determined to protect Lyra, led a group of rebels into battle, a battle that would decide the fate of the kingdom and the very essence of love.
In the heart of the forest, amidst the roar of the battle and the cries of the fallen, Lyra stood at the crossroads of her destiny. She felt the pull of her father's darkness and the warmth of Kael's love. With a heart torn between two worlds, she made a choice that would change everything.
Lyra stepped forward, her eyes glowing with the light of her dual heritage. She summoned the power within her, a force so great that it split the very earth beneath them. With a single gesture, she banished the darkness that threatened to consume her, choosing instead to embrace the light of her human spirit.
The demon king, witnessing the power of his child's love, was humbled. He saw the error of his ways and, in a moment of revelation, he forgave Lyra and Kael, recognizing that true power lay in love and understanding, not in fear and dominance.
The kingdom was saved, and Lyra and Kael, now husband and wife, ruled together, their love a beacon of hope for a world that had once been divided. The child of the demon king became the symbol of unity, a testament to the power of forbidden love.
And so, the tale of Lyra, the child of the demon king, became a legend, a story of love that could overcome all, a story that would be told for generations to come.
